Eggs in the fridge (soy too). I'll take a couple out the night before if I'm having boiled eggs for brekky, otherwise the shells tend to crack open in the pan.

 

I used to store chocolate in the fridge during summer but read somewhere that this is a bad idea, flavour-wise.

 

Mustard, mayo, tomato sauce, etc all go in the fridge.


it is i think, but the chocolate would melt in summer and that's not good flavourwise either. these advices usually come from people who live in cooler climates than most of us.

when they say that you shouldn't put chocolate into the fridge it does not come to their mind that outside the fridge it's over 40 degrees....
